@charset "UTF-8";html,body{height:100%}html,button,input,select,textarea{color:#555}body{background-color:#fff}img{vertical-align:middle}fieldset{border:0;margin:0;padding:0}textarea{resize:vertical}.browsehappy{margin:0.2em 0;background:#ccc;color:#000;padding:0.2em 0}menu{padding:0;margin:0}h1,h2,h3{font-weight:normal;margin:0;padding:0}p,pre{margin:0}a{color:#111;text-decoration:none}a:hover{color:#666;text-decoration:underline}a:focus,a:active,a:hover{outline:0}.clearfix:before,.clearfix:after{content:" ";display:table}.clearfix:after{clear:both}.clearfix{*zoom:1}.relative{position:relative}.text-center{text-align:center}*,*:before,*:after{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}body{font:14px/24px arial,sans-serif}.none{display:none !important}iframe{padding:0;margin:0;overflow:hidden}.container{padding-right:15px;padding-left:15px;margin-right:auto;margin-left:auto}.container:before,.container:after{display:table;content:" "}.container:after{clear:both}.row{margin-right:-15px;margin-left:-15px}.row:before,.row:after{display:table;content:" "}.row:after{clear:both}.cols_20,.cols_25,.cols_30,.cols_33,.cols_35,.cols_40,.cols_45,.cols_50,.cols_60,.cols_66,.cols_70,.cols_75,.cols_80,.cols_85,.cols_100{min-height:1px;padding-left:15px;padding-right:15px;position:relative}.cols_100{width:100%}@media only screen and (max-width:768px){.cols_20,.cols_25,.cols_30,.cols_33,.cols_35,.cols_40,.cols_45,.cols_50,.cols_60,.cols_66,.cols_70,.cols_75,.cols_80,.cols_85{width:50%;float:left}}@media only screen and (max-width:650px){.cols_20,.cols_25,.cols_30,.cols_33,.cols_35,.cols_40,.cols_45,.cols_50,.cols_60,.cols_66,.cols_70,.cols_75,.cols_80,.cols_85{float:none;width:100%}}@media only screen and (min-width:769px){.cols_20{width:20%}.cols_25{width:25%}.cols_30{width:30%}.cols_33{width:33.33333333333333%}.cols_35{width:35%}.cols_40{width:40%}.cols_45{width:45%}.cols_50{width:50%}.cols_60{width:60%}.cols_66{width:66.66666666666666%}.cols_70{width:70%}.cols_75{width:75%}.cols_80{width:80%}.cols_85{width:85%}.cols_20,.cols_25,.cols_30,.cols_33,.cols_35,.cols_40,.cols_45,.cols_50,.cols_60,.cols_66,.cols_70,.cols_75,.cols_80,.cols_85,.cols_100{float:left}}@media only screen and (min-width:1300px){.container{width:1170px;margin:0 auto}}.header_container{border-bottom:1px solid #eee;padding:40px 0 20px}.main_container{padding:50px 0;background:#f5f5f5}.main_container.whitebg{background:#fff}.footer_container{border-top:1px solid #eee;padding:20px 0 40px;text-align:center}.logo{margin:0 auto;width:200px;height:28px}.logo a{display:block;text-indent:-9000px;width:200px;height:28px;background-image:url('https://www.pyhajarve.com/templates/template/css/img/logo.png');background-size:200px 28px;background-position:0 0;background-repeat:no-repeat}.slogan{text-align:center}.outer_wrapper{padding:20px;border:1px solid #ccc;background:#fff;margin:20px 0}.main_container ul{list-style:disc;padding-left:15px;margin-top:10px}.main_container ul li{padding-left:7px}.btn_demo{display:inline-block;outline:0;background:#222;color:#fff;font-size:16px;line-height:24px;text-align:center;padding:7px 20px;margin:15px 0 0}.btn_demo:hover{background:#999;color:#fff}.bigtitle h2:first-child{font-size:30px;line-height:33px;text-align:center;margin:20px 0}.blackButton{border:0;margin:10px 0 0;padding:10px 30px;height:auto;background:%bookNowBgColor%;color:#fff;font-size:18px}.blackButton:hover{background:#bbb;color:#111}
